Why Are We Seeing More Cases of Hearing Loss?
Hearing loss isn't confined to the elderly; it's becoming alarmingly prevalent across all age groups. The contemporary world we inhabit is louder than ever before, exposing us to hazardous noise levels from activities such as attending concerts, commuting, and frequent use of headphones. Dr. Marcelo Rivolta, a leading expert on hearing loss, articulates this, noting that noise exposure significantly raises the incidence of hearing loss. Moreover, our aging population directly contributes to the increase in hearing loss cases, compounded by a growing reliance on digital devices that often come with inadequate volume controls.
How Loud Noises and Headphones Affect Our Hearing
Headphones offer a world of auditory enjoyment, especially among younger generations. However, Dr. Rivolta warns that reckless use—especially at loud volumes—can lead to irreversible damage. Evidence suggests that temporary hearing loss may follow short bouts of loud noise, but prolonged exposure can lead to permanent auditory impairment. Listening at levels above 60 decibels poses a risk, escalating to greater danger at 70 decibels and beyond. To illustrate, a pneumatic drill averages around 100 decibels—far higher than safe listening levels in headphones.
Benefits of Early Intervention and Treatment Options
Interestingly, research indicates that using hearing aids not only amplifies sound but significantly reduces cognitive overload. When patients are aided in their ability to hear, they experience less strain on their brain, potentially lowering their risk of cognitive decline. Yet, while hearing aids and cochlear implants serve as assistive technologies, they do have limitations—they won’t restore hearing for everyone and rely on the presence of certain auditory cells to be effective. For those who lack these cells, a promising area of research focuses on stem cell technology as a potential biological cure for hearing loss.
The Future of Hearing Restoration
What does the future hold for treating hearing loss? Dr. Rivolta’s groundbreaking lab at the University of Sheffield is on the brink of major advancements. Through the use of stem cells, researchers aim to regenerate crucial auditory cells in the cochlea, offering hope for those with irreversible hearing damage. As preparations are underway to begin human trials, stakeholders remain optimistic that within a few years, this could lead to effective treatments, radically shifting our current approach to hearing loss.
Taking Action: Protecting Your Hearing Health
For individuals concerned about their hearing health, proactive measures and lifestyle choices can make a substantial difference. Limit exposure to loud sounds, practice responsible headphone usage—keeping volumes within safe limits—and consider regular hearing evaluations as you age. If you begin experiencing symptoms of hearing impairment, don’t hesitate to consult a healthcare professional. Early intervention is key to maintaining hearing health and mitigating associated risks.
